Jessica van Dop DeJesus grew up with the best of both worlds: the tropics of Puerto Rico and the nature of upstate New York. She has spent most of her adult life abroad, first as a United States Marine Officer, then as a graduate student, and subsequently as a civil servant. When I think of my friend Charles McCool , I think of the word he coined, “funness.” If there were a word that could describe Charles, it would be fun. How he would show up at travel media events in his bright Hawaiian shirts and laid-back style. He had a casual way of working the room and making friends with everyone; he captivated us with his fun stories about his travels and his crazy luck at winning random prizes. Not only did he win two cars, but he also won a few giveaways at our DC Travel Blogger Meetups, where we got to know him not only as a great travel writer but as a friend. Our hearts dropped when we heard that Charles had suddenly passed away earlier last month at the age of 61. Another heartbreaking reminder of how fragile life can be. We had dinner with Charles and Julie last year in Brussels, and he looked so full of life with many plans ahead. Sending his wife Julie and his children my love and thinking about all the times of funness we had together throughout the years 🙏🏽

Where to have lunch in Pozzallo, Sicily. My friend recommended we head to Pozzallo in the southeast coast of Sicily to have lunch at a family owned seaside restaurant. You must order the crudo platter of fresh Sicilian seafood to include tuna and the gambero rosso. Can’t wait to go back!
